"MLB acknowledges warning the players, saying that this violates the uniform policy. They're not allowed to write on their uniforms. And the MLB says this is not a disciplinary action. It has absolutely nothing to do with the content of the messages that they put on their caps."
Major League Baseball warned three San Francisco Giants pitchers for inscribing Bible verses on their Pride Night caps, citing uniform policy violations, despite having previously allowed Black Lives Matter messaging stenciled on pitching mounds and jersey patches for over a year. The contradiction sparked accusations of anti-Christian bias, with Senator Josh Hawley sending a letter to Commissioner Rob Manfred calling out a pattern of discrimination against Christian ballplayers.
